Who are we?
Stockton Riverside College is a vibrant, forward-facing college which offers high-quality standards of education, providing a full range of academic, vocational and higher education courses for young people, adult learners and apprenticeships. We are proud to serve our local community by helping people gain the skills, knowledge and confidence to reach their full potential.
We are part of the Education Training Collective (Etc.), which is of a group of colleges in the Tees Valley; Stockton Riverside College, Redcar and Cleveland College, Bede Sixth Form College, NETA Training and The Skills Academy. An exciting opportunity has arisen for a Progress Coach to join our outstanding ESOL (English for Speakers of Other Languages) team, reporting to our Curriculum Manager.
As a Progress Coach with Stockton Riverside College, you will be responsible for working with cohorts of 16-18 and 19+ ESOL learners throughout the academic year. You will support with the College Tutorial Programme, track attendance, monitor behaviour, and support individual students within the department. You will provide further assistance with a range of financial, academic, social, and emotional issues that may significantly impact a student's progress.
Additionally, you will:
* Offer effective support to students individually or in group settings to support their success.
* Provide a range of holistic support to ensure a well-rounded approach to student support.
* Liaise closely with relevant staff to support students identified as at risk.
The ideal candidate will have relevant experience supporting 16-18 and 19+ learners and will be committed to educational excellence with excellent oral and written communication skills.
